Analysis

UNICEF: Middle East and North Africa Programme Countries recorded 258,877 for total inbound internationally mobile students, female in 2023. That is the highest value across all 22 years on record.

That represents a change of up 5.4% on the previous year and up 104.2% over ten years.

Over the whole period, total inbound internationally mobile students, female in UNICEF: Middle East and North Africa Programme Countries peaked at 258,877 in 2023 and was at its lowest, 54,693, in 2002.

UNICEF: Middle East and North Africa Programme Countries ranks 55th of 204 groups on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Total inbound internationally mobile students, female in UNICEF: Middle East and North Africa Programme Countries, year by year

Annual values for Total inbound internationally mobile students, female (number) in UNICEF: Middle East and North Africa Programme Countries, 2002 to 2023.
Year Value Change
2002 54,693
2003 57,477 +5.1%
2004 58,416 +1.6%
2005 58,828 +0.7%
2006 62,340 +6.0%
2007 70,061 +12.4%
2008 77,994 +11.3%
2009 84,316 +8.1%
2010 93,428 +10.8%
2011 98,742 +5.7%
2012 104,997 +6.3%
2013 126,794 +20.8%
2014 151,593 +19.6%
2015 169,262 +11.7%
2016 188,316 +11.3%
2017 200,131 +6.3%
2018 211,015 +5.4%
2019 215,699 +2.2%
2020 216,261 +0.3%
2021 227,119 +5.0%
2022 245,515 +8.1%
2023 258,877 +5.4%
